Australia's India Tour: A 21-Year Wait for Series Glory

Can the Aussies finally break their Indian jinx in 2026?

CricPlay1 min read

Australia has just unveiled their home schedule for 2026-27, but all eyes are really on their upcoming tour to India. The last time the Baggy Greens clinched a Test series in India was back in 2004-05. That’s a whopping 21 years of hurt, and it’s clearly sticking in their craw.

The Australian squad is itching to turn the tide after years of coming up short on Indian soil. This isn’t just about the series; it’s a matter of pride. Australia’s cricketing legacy is at stake, and a victory in India could be the cherry on top of their already illustrious history.

As they prepare for this monumental challenge, expect a mix of intense training and strategic planning. The players know the conditions will challenge them, but they also know that nothing beats the thrill of finally conquering the subcontinent. The countdown to 2026 is officially on!
